covlass Posted September 13, 2007 Share Posted September 13, 2007 Can someone help my sisters pc is playing up everytime she logs on the internet (talk talk) her home page shows but if she tried to view another it says "please wait whilst we redirect you" it says done but page is blank. This happens no matter which page she tries to view. She has ran her virus scan but nothing is showing up. She has done disc clean up and defrag. She then tried to reinstall to previouse date but is unable to do so as calendar is blank! Any ideas We are not PC experts but we need help as her daughter has to do her homework on line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Any ideasWe are not PC experts but we need help as her daughter has to do her homework on line Hi, Now you wrote you did a virus scan, do it have a spyware engine included? Else try run a spywarescan? Did you install any new software lately? (system restore aint a 100% fix), also try run CCleaner , maybe it will detect some abnormalities? it?s worth a try. else try to reinstall the network drivers (remove it from the device properties, and restart windows, make sure you have the drivers if it?s not plug'and'play), that have worked for me sometimes when network act up.
